BALFOUR BEATTY APPOINTS MELODY MEYER AND SANDRA STASH AS NON-EXECUTIVE DIRECTORS
Balfour Beatty, the international infrastructure group, today announces the appointment of Melody Meyer and Sandra (Sandy) Stash as Non-Executive Directors of the Company and members of the Remuneration Committee, with effect from 13 July 2026.
Melody Meyer
Melody brings extensive international board and executive experience across complex, capital intensive and safety critical industries. She currently serves as a Non-Executive Director, Chair of the Public Policy & Sustainability Committee and member of the Audit Committee of AbbVie Inc and as a Non-Executive Director of Airswift Parent LLC. She previously served as a Non-Executive Director on the boards of NOV Inc. and of BP plc, where she chaired the Safety and Sustainability Committee and was a member of the Remuneration Committee.
Prior to her non-executive positions, Melody had a distinguished 37-year executive career with Chevron, culminating in her role as President of Chevron Asia Pacific Exploration & Production, where she was responsible for large-scale international operations, major capital projects and a workforce of over 11,000 employees across multiple jurisdictions.

Sandy Stash
Sandy is a highly experienced international Non-Executive Director with a strong track record across infrastructure, energy and capital-intensive industries. She currently serves on the boards of ACWA Power and Trans Mountain Company, where share chairs the Operations and HSE Committee, and has previously held Non-Executive Director roles at Diversified Energy Company plc, where she was Senior Independent Director, EVRAZ plc, Medallion Midstream, Lucid Energy, and Chaarat Gold.
Sandy's executive career spans over four decades in the global energy sector, including senior leadership roles at Tullow Oil including Executive Vice President, Safety, Operations and Engineering, Talisman Energy and BP America. She has deep expertise in operational excellence, engineering, safety-critical environments, risk management and the delivery of large-scale, complex projects across international markets.

Notes to editors:
· Balfour Beatty is a leading international infrastructure group delivering the complex, critical infrastructure that keeps economies moving and communities connected.
· With around 26,000 employees, we finance, develop, build, maintain and operate essential infrastructure across the UK, US and Asia, combining deep engineering and construction expertise with long-term investment capability.
· For over one hundred years, we have delivered landmark projects around the world. Today, our teams are helping to deliver major programmes including Hinkley Point C, the UK's first new nuclear power station in a generation; the Lyric Theatre in Hong Kong, a world-class cultural venue at the heart of the West Kowloon Cultural District; and the Knox Street Development in Dallas, Texas, a major mixed-use scheme helping to reshape one of the city's most vibrant neighbourhoods.
